It's a great release for anyone who likes physical media, and missed out or didn't want to spend $40 on the "Illuminated Star Projection Edition" 2CD set from 2014

 

if you're a digital buyer, all this music is already on the "Deluxe Version" of the score that's been sold digitally (not to mention streaming free on Spotify, etc) for the past 6 years....  except for the one new track (Day One Dark), which you might have legally obtained for free back in the day via movie-tickets.com

The only difference between the 2CD set released in 2014 and the 2CD set released this month, is the 2014 said had one less track (it did not have Day One Dark), and did have a bunch of extra packaging stuff (some sort of light-up star display or something)
